By now, everyone has either wrapped themselves in or completely moved on from Comedian Kosaka Daimaou's standup persona's global viral hit, PPAP. The global phenomenon has spawned swanky outfits and even a cafe in Tokyo with a super predictable menu. Needless to say, many parodies on YouTube have been released since the song took off, but none make quite as much sense as this Death Note version released to help promote the new Death Note film Death Note: Light up the NEW World.
The parody features the mysterious but charming Ryuk, a shinigami with a noted fondness for apples. It only seems appropriate that Ryuk would join in on the viral craze, partly as a means of getting his deathly hands on apples, and perhaps as a covert way of collecting souls.
